Kuwait city module solar
This guide explores the primary environmental challenges for solar modules in Kuwait—extreme heat and abrasive sand—and outlines the specific engineering and material science solutions needed to ensure long-term performance and durability. . A standard solar module, rated at 500 watts under ideal laboratory conditions, may only produce 400 watts or less during a typical summer afternoon in Kuwait. This significant drop in performance is not due to a fault in the module itself, but rather a mismatch between its design and the demanding. .
